After approximately 1.5 hours, you’ll arrive in Bern, a city that feels both grand and intimate. Founded in 1191, Bern’s Old Town is a masterpiece of medieval architecture, built on a sandstone ridge surrounded by the turquoise loop of the Aare River. The Zytglogge, a 15th-century astronomical clock, still marks the hours with animated figures — a symbol of Bern’s timeless rhythm. Nearby stands the Federal Palace, where Swiss democracy quietly governs the nation.

Take time to explore the Bern Cathedral, the tallest church in Switzerland, with panoramic views from its 100-meter tower. History and intellect meet at the Einstein House Museum, where the scientist’s early years in Bern are preserved in the apartment he once called home. Strolling through the arcades, you’ll find charming cafés, bookstores, and chocolate shops that make Bern one of Europe’s most walkable and livable capitals.

After discovering Bern’s historic heart, your journey continues to Thun, the gateway to the Bernese Oberland. As you approach, the scenery changes — the flat plateau gives way to lakes and mountains. Thun’s medieval center, built along the Aare River, is known for its unique split-level streets lined with wooden arcades and riverside cafés.

Climb up to Thun Castle, a perfectly preserved fortress with views stretching over Lake Thun and the distant Eiger, Mönch, and Jungfrau peaks. Below, the river flows through the city, its clear alpine water reflecting the pastel façades of centuries-old houses. If time allows, the tour continues a short distance along the lake to Schloss Oberhofen, where the elegant castle seems to float directly on the turquoise surface of Lake Thun — a perfect spot for photos.
